VPS为什么要定期重启?_全面解析定期重启的必要性与最佳实践

VPS为什么要定期重启?定期重启有哪些好处和注意事项?

重启频率 适用场景 优点 注意事项
每月一次 常规维护 清除内存泄漏、进程堆积 选择低流量时段
每周一次 高负载环境 保持最佳性能 提前通知用户
按需重启 特殊需求 解决特定问题 备份重要数据

VPS定期重启的必要性与最佳实践

VPS(Virtual Private Server)作为虚拟专用服务器,在长期运行过程中会出现各种问题,定期重启是维护VPS健康运行的重要措施。本文将详细探讨VPS定期重启的原因、必要性、最佳实践以及常见问题解决方案。

一、VPS定期重启的原因

  1. 优化性能:长时间运行的VPS容易出现内存泄漏、进程堆积等问题,这些问题会导致性能下降。定期重启可以清除这些问题,使VPS重新获得最佳性能^^1^^。
  2. 解决常见问题:系统更新和软件安装后可能需要重新启动才能生效。此外,某些服务或进程可能会出现异常,导致其无法正常工作,定期重启可清除这些问题^^1^^。
  3. 提升安全性:定期重启有助于提升安全性。操作系统和应用程序可能会积累漏洞和安全问题,通过在重启时重新加载系统和软件组件,可以及时应用最新的安全修复程序和更新^^1^^。

二、VPS定期重启的最佳实践

  1. 设置合理的重启频率
  • 一般建议每月重启一次
  • 高负载环境可考虑每周一次
  • 特殊需求可按需重启
  1. 选择合适的时间段
  • 在业务低峰期进行重启
  • 避免在用户访问高峰期操作
  • 提前通知用户重启计划
  1. 自动化重启设置
  • Linux系统可使用crontab设置定时任务
  • Windows系统可通过任务计划程序设置
  • 宝塔面板用户可通过计划任务功能设置
# Linux设置定时重启示例(crontab)
0 5   * reboot  # 每天凌晨5点重启

三、VPS定期重启的常见问题及解决方案

问题 原因 解决方案
重启后服务未自动启动 服务未设置为开机自启 检查并设置服务为开机自启动
重启后配置丢失 配置未正确保存 检查配置文件保存位置和权限
重启时间过长 系统资源占用过高 优化系统和服务配置
重启失败 硬件或系统故障 联系服务商检查硬件状态

四、注意事项

  1. 数据备份:重启前确保重要数据已备份,避免意外丢失^^2^^。
  2. 服务检查:重启后检查关键服务是否正常运行,如Web服务器、数据库等^^3^^。
  3. 日志分析:定期检查系统日志,分析是否有异常情况^^2^^。
  4. 资源监控:使用系统监控工具(如top、htop等)定期检查VPS的资源使用情况^^2^^。
通过合理的定期重启策略,可以显著提高VPS的稳定性和安全性,为用户提供更可靠的服务体验。

发表评论

评论列表